    The tile shop is gigantic with dozens of aisles of sample tiles as well as incredible bath and kitchen designs. And, it did appear that they were only staffed with 2 salespeople (that we saw) and both were busy with other customers. We roamed around on our own and found the wood-like tile we liked as well as river rock pebble tile for the shower floor, but we still had questions and waited patiently for someone to help us. After about 20-30 minutes, a young man named Shahin offered his assistance. He was knowledgeable, patient, kind and very helpful. He gave great advice and educated us on the difference between porcelain and ceramic tiles. Based on his guidance, we decided to also replace the flooring in our bathroom, so our purchase was substantial. I had planned to write down the tile info and do some comparison shopping online, but because of this young man's assistance, we placed the order on the spot, without hesitation. My suggestion is to take advantage of the ability to roam around the large showroom without being hounded, and exercise some patience when waiting for a salesperson. It's definitely worth the wait!

    After unpleasant experiences at other tile places, I found myself here at the Tile Shop. Large showroom. Lots of choices. For the most part, helpful staff. After a painstaking process of choosing among beige travertine or beige travertine (ugh - yes, really), hubby and I finally selected. The price was high, very high... but I could not find the same tile elsewhere... I came VERY close with what is called "Tumbled Marble" or "Tumbled Travertine" at Lowes and Home Depot. But the samples we had from The Tile Shop seemed to be more consistent in color and higher grade (less holes all the way through the tiles). We were only doing a backsplash, so we "sucked it up" and paid the nearly double per square foot price. Good news: -Tile came in as expected. Pick up was easy. It was the proper amount. Bad news: -The samples were the highest quality... the actual tiles received were of mixed quality and less consistent in color. Basically, the boxes for 1/3 the price at Home Depot and Lowes would have done just fine. A couple tips for those purchasing Travertine... (1) I learned through the process that it makes a difference if you use "sealer" or a "sealer/enhancer"... both are nice but they give a very different look. The way the tiles look normally in the show room when you are looking at samples is pretty close to the way the tile will look with just a sealer. We used an enhancer and it "enhances" the variances in the stone. To see what that looks like, rub the sample tiles with water. You'll see there can be a very big difference. (2) With Honed Tumbled Marble or Travertine, you can choose to purchase tiles which are "honed and filled" (a rustic look but smoothish finish - not polished, just smooth) or honed (and unfilled). When it is purchased honed and unfilled and then installed, the grout files the holes and gives it nearly the same look you'll get by purchasing honed & filled tile. When you purchase filled it's always filled with a white substance that I swear is grout. If you purchase unfilled you can have it "filled" with whatever color grout you choose. Darker grout gives the stone a darker look, lighter grout gives it a lighter look. (Note that the sales people all said "if the installer puts the sealant on before grouting and is very careful they can avoid filling the holes with the grout."... Um, not really - at least not practically. And um, then I would have HOLES showing straight through to the adhesive. That would be terrible. I like the way it looks filled in anyway, but I can't imagine how you could have it done any other way. We went a tad darker than the stone, matching other things in the room. My friend used white grout and did not use the enhancer... it's a VERY different look. Both are nice - but know what you want.
